Ester Henning
Ester Matilda Henning was a Swedish artist. From 1919 she spent the remaining 60 years of her life in a mental institution.
Ester Matilda Henning was born on 28 October 1887 in Yngshyttan outside Filipstad. She was born fourth of seven daughters to a poor cobbler. She moved to Mora at the age of 12 to work as a nanny.
Her art has been exhibited at three main exhibitions: in 1946 in Gothenburg, in 1963 at the Beckomberga Hospital and in 1970 at the Liljevalchs konsthall in Stockholm.
In 2009 Maud Nycander and Kersti Grunditz made a documentary about her life and her art that was shown on Sveriges Television.
Anna Jörgensdotter wrote a novel in 2015 inspired by her life titled Drömmen om Ester.
